Browse Veteran Owned Businesses
Filter Results
Business Listings for Natick, Massachusetts
Look for the icon to find special VOB offers.
StratComm Inc | Natick, MA 01760 StratComm, Inc. is strategic marketing and communications firm; we have been in business for more than thirty years. We are a ... |